.z { float: left; }
.y { float: right; }
.hm { text-align: center; }
.zoom { cursor: pointer; }
.zoominner { padding: 5px 10px 10px; background: #FFF; text-align: left; }
.zoominner p { padding: 8px 0; text-align: right }
.zoominner p a { float: left; margin-left: 10px; width: 17px; height: 17px; background: url(imgzoom_tb.gif) no-repeat 0 0; line-height: 100px; overflow: hidden; }
.zoominner p a:hover { background-position: 0 -39px; }
.zoominner p a.imgadjust { background-position: -40px 0; }
.zoominner p a.imgadjust:hover { background-position: -40px -39px; }
.zoominner p a.imgclose { background-position: -80px 0; }
.zoominner p a.imgclose:hover { background-position: -80px -39px; }
.zimg_c { position: relative; }
.zimg_prev, .zimg_next { display: block; position: absolute; width: 55px; height: 100%; cursor: pointer; text-indent: -9999px; }
.zimg_c img { margin: 0 auto; }
.zimg_p strong { display: none; }
.zimg_prev { left: -55px; background-image: url(left.png); background-repeat: no-repeat; background-position: left center !important; }
.zimg_next { right: -55px; background-image: url(right.png); background-repeat: no-repeat; background-position: right center !important; }
.imgzoom_title { top: 10px; position: absolute }
.gallery{ margin-bottom:70px;}
#imgzoom_zoomlayer{ height:auto !important}
#imgzoom_imglink{ display:none!important}